Diary concerning chiefly religious matters, mostly Puritanical confessions of Tompson's piety not living up to the expectation of the Lord. There is also mention of the many afflictions God is "pleased" to bestow upon Tompson's wife.

The diary also includes 12 poems by Tompson's brother, Benjamin Tompson; John Wilson; Samuel Danforth; Samuel Torrey; and, presumably, Anna Hayden.

Autograph manuscript, signed; dated consistently 1666-1679, with the 1723 entries on the back flyleaf and the 1726 entries on the front flyleaf and first two leaves.

Bound in calf with loose materials in a protective case.

Tompson was born in Braintree, Mass. and worked as a minister in Billerica.

The poems are published in: Kenneth B. Murdock, Handkerchiefs from Paul (Cambridge, 1927)

MS Am 929. Houghton Library, Harvard University.
